2024 timeline entry, 14:22 — Catalog cache invalidation failure (Merrowmart storefront). The Pricewell service published updated SKU prices, but the edge cache in the Dunmore region never received the invalidation fan-out because the broker topic was misconfigured after the morning deploy. Stale prices served for 47 minutes. Mitigation: manual cache flush at 15:09, broker config corrected at 15:31. Release manager action: hold further regional deploys until verification. The implicated deploy's token is recorded below.

trace token, fafog-kageg: htk4_98e6

- [ ] Step 7: Archive cold storage buckets (Glacierline tier). Confirm both ceremony witnesses are present, verify bucket manifests match the Oxbow ledger, then seal the archive key shares. Plugin authors may observe but not handle shares. Once sealed, the archive index itself is encrypted and can only be reopened with the passphrase below.

vault phrase of badup-hahig = tamael-aldael-kelmir-istael-fenok-istwyn-tamius-jorath-oliion

Finance Review — Project Kestrel. Target: Marwick Tooling, Aldenport. Revenue steady, margins thin; debt manageable. Valuation range acceptable at the lower band only. Diligence flagged two lease liabilities, both quantified. Recommendation: proceed to second-round talks, cap offer per the model. Integration costs remain the main risk. The confidential note below outlines the strategic rationale the board has approved.

confidential, kagep-kahof: Druokax Systems plans to lower the Ulaath list price by 53 percent in March.

## Onboarding: Fareweight Rules Engine

Fareweight computes shipping fees from stacked rule sets. Rules are versioned; never edit a live version. Deploys go through the staging evaluator first. Read the rule DSL guide before touching anything.

Rule definitions live in the pricing database — connect to it with the connection string below.

primary connection of yagep-bajop = postgresql://druiel_svc:gW@db-3860.sivrelworks.example:5432/brieth